Your Venue's Neighborhood


In Selecting A Wedding Venue, Some Couples

Like To Consider The Photos They'll Be Taking

In & Around The Venue's Neighborhood.

We often advise couples who are shooting an engagement session with their [wedding] photographer to consider a setting and overall look that will contrast their wedding photos. Sometimes, you can apply the same approach to the neighborhood around your venue. Lauren and David's wedding at Weylin in Brooklyn is a great example.

For their January 2018 wedding, Lauren and David wanted something cool and different. Their planner, Björn VW (Björn & Company Event Planning & Design) helped them find Weylin. The venue's bold, majestic, stylish interior made for a spectacular wedding with a gorgeous atmosphere (see: Take This Wedding To The BANK!). At the same time, Weylin's Williamsburg neighborhood offered a gritty, textured- but equally stylish- setting, full of character and charm.

Whether walking the blocks down to the East River, overlooking the Williamsburg Bridge and the Manhattan skyline...

...or taking over the streets with their bridal party...

...Weylin's neighborhood made for fantastic wedding images that offered a wonderful contrast to the photos taken inside Lauren and David's venue.
